Product Overview

This Kindle book, published by St. Martin’s Press on March 7, 2023, is a detailed exploration of political intelligence and WWII biographies, spanning 347 pages in English. It features enhanced accessibility with screen reader support, X-Ray for deeper insights, and Word Wise to aid comprehension. With an ISBN-13 of 978-1250280251 and a file size of 18.3 MB, it combines rigorous research with digital convenience, ranking highly in categories like Intelligence & Espionage and WWII Biographies. The book’s specifications ensure a seamless reading experience, backed by positive customer reviews averaging 4.1 stars from 190 ratings.
